#1bf647 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1bf647 is composed of 10.6% red, 96.5% green and 27.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89% cyan, 0% magenta, 71.1%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 132.1 degrees, a saturation of 92.4% and a lightness of 53.5%. #1bf647 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ff8e with #00ed00.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

Shades and Tints of #1bf647

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#011104 is the darkest color, while #fdfff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bf647

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#888988 is the less saturated color, while #1bf647 is the most saturated one.
